NMSU Grants General Education Associate’s Program

All of the 2 students who graduated with a Associate’s in education from NMSU Grants in 2021 were women.

undefined

The majority of associate's degree recipients in this major at NMSU Grants are white. In the most recent graduating class for which data is available, 100% of students fell into this category.
